我正在使用POSTGRESQL数据库通过LaravelPassport安装一个新的API。在安装Laravel和basic身份验证时,它可以很好地注册用户并完美地登录。(以数据库为例,这很重要!)但是,当按照步骤安装Passport并运行"php artisan migrate“命令时,Passport没有识别出我正在使用POSTGRESQL,并查找到MYSQL的连接,而MYSQL是不存在的。`expires_at` datetime nu
我正在为我的laravel应用程序中的每个客户端注册创建数据库。我已经安装了用于授权的护照。我已经成功地创建了数据库并为passport运行了迁移。passport:install命令对新创建的数据库无效。有没有办法为我的新数据库运行命令passport:install。DBHelper::connect($dbName) : Create new database config and then DB::reconnect()
我正在使用Tenancy For Laravel创建一个基于子域的多租户laravel项目,除了尝试使用Passport验证我的应用程序接口请求之外,一切都运行得很好。它现在的工作方式是,我有一个主数据库(多租户),我在其中声明租户并指定各自的子域,然后每个租户都有自己的数据库(tenantfoo)。我通过了Auth::check,并在正确的数据库中检查了凭证,但是当我尝试创建令牌时,它将停止使用租户数据库(tenantfoo),并尝试在主数据